Improving City for Seniors: Action Plan Clarity Needed
The Kungsholmen District Council has reviewed a proposed new action plan for an age-friendly city, intended to replace the previous "Action Plan for an Elder-Friendly City." The council recommends clarifying the target group (whether it includes only the elderly or all ages) and defining clear responsibilities for implementation, as these aspects are currently ambiguous. They also request that follow-up procedures include concrete measures and timeframes to ensure consistent and effective work across Stockholm.
